Members of Caraga SWD LNet, convene for quarterly meeting

To enhance the delivery of services to our diverse stakeholders, members of the Caraga Social Welfare and Development Learning Network (SWD LNet) convened on April 4, 2024, for a Quarterly Meeting. DSWD, LBP Managers gather to strategize on UCT implementation program

The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Field Office Caraga and Officers from the Landbank of the Philippines (LBP) met today, April 4, 2024, to strategize the implementation of the Unconditional Cash Transfer (UCT) program in the region. Fire Victims in SurSur, AgNor receive food, non-food items from DSWD

Some 28 fire-affected families in Butuan City received food and non-food items (F/NFI) from the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Field Office Caraga on March 14, 2024. The affected families are from the barangays of Imadejas (16), Doongan (7), Agusan Pequeño (2), Baan Riverside (1), JP Rizal (1), and Villa Kananga (1).
